Vacation Bible school pairs Scripture lessons, research

 
By Dawn Marks
Published: June 17, 2008

EDMOND — Students at Peace Lutheran Church's vacation Bible school made some science miracles.

During last week's Power Lab Vacation Bible School , students shot off Diet Coke rockets using Mentos candies, made a little slime and even walked on water using a solution of water and cornstarch.

"If you walk quickly, you don't sink,” said Julia Cohlmia , Peace Lutheran's director of children's ministry.
